Ministry of Defence

As part of the Government’s ongoing Swachh Bharat Abhiyan, the Department of Defence (DoD) initiated the implementation phase of the Special Campaign 5.0. The theme for this year’s campaign is ‘disposal of e-waste’.

The activities will focus on disposing of obsolete IT equipment and generating wealth from waste, according to a Ministry of Defence statement.

During the preparatory phase of the special campaign 5.0 on Swachhata, the Department has identified pendencies across various parameters viz. MP references, public grievances, Inter-Ministerial Consultations, Parliamentary Assurances and State Government references, among others.

The locations/offices identified for carrying out the Swachhata Abhiyan possess a pan-India spread. These locations include various organisations/attached offices such as the Controller General of Defence Accounts, Border Roads Organisation, Directorate General of Armed Forces Medical Services, Directorate General of National Cadet Corps, Indian Coast Guard, Sainik Schools Society, Canteen Stores Department, and the Cantonments.

The locations include the Nehru Institute of Mountaineering, Uttarkashi; the National Institute of Mountaineering and Adventure Sports, Dirang (Arunachal Pradesh); the Jawahar Institute of Mountaineering and Winter Sports, Pahalgam (J&K); and the Himalayan Mountaineering Institute, Darjeeling.

The emphasis will be on ensuring a cleaner and decluttered workplace, which eventually culminates in enhanced productivity.
